KODJOVI KUSH & AFROSPOT ALL STARS - LOVE IN AFRICA


Led by the charismatic singer and musician Kodjovi Kush, this band is all about the joyous sounds of West African music: highlife, afrobeat and ‘agbadjazz’ - a fusion of the traditional 6/8 agbadja music of the Ewe people from Togo, Ghana and Benin with jazz and reggae influences.

Born in Togo, Kodjovi grew up in a musical environment.
Inspired by his father, who used to tour Africa with his bands Eryko Jazz de la Capitale and Los Muchachos in the 50s and 60s, he started his first band at the age of 15.
In the 90s, after touring Europe with some traditional groups from Togo, he settled in London. There he formed the band Jah’s Afrik and joined Ibile, the Soothsayers and Yesking as a bass player and vocalist, playing mainly reggae and African music.
During this time he performed with great artists such as Tony Allen, Seun Kuti, Alpha Blondy, Gregory Isaacs and many others.  

Eventually Kodjovi created the Afrospot club night, named after Fela Kuti’s first nightclub in Lagos.It was frequented by some of London’s finest musicians, and soon the Afrospot All Stars were born: a collective of seasoned players from all over West Africa and the UK.
